101028 tn?1419603004
zovirax cream is pretty much useless for genital herpes infections. If you didn't fill the script yet, consider not doing so.  

I really recommend reading the herpes handbook at www.westoverheights.com when you get a chance. it's free to read online and it's chock full of terrific info on herpes.

can you also call the clinic today and ask them what your herpes test results are and write them down to post here? all i need you to post is hsv1 igg 4.4 and hsv2 igg 3.3 or whatever they are. That way i can see if you were properly tested and if you need additional testing done or not.

A rash all over the body isn't due to herpes.  did your provider have any ideas what was causing it?  did they also test you vaginally for yeast and bacterial infections at your appointment?
